Despite the fact that I am a car nut I have never really been into motor sports. I find things like F1, WRC and Nascar interesting, but I wouldn’t go out of my way to watch them. The one exception to this is the Dakar Rally. I love the Dakar because of the variety of vehicles and the raw emotion that is involved with the series. As you all probably know the Dakar has been moved from Africa to South America for security reasons. Despite this it looks like the race is going to be just as challenging or even more challenging than it usually is. The event will start in Buenos Aries on the 3rd of January and will have competitors crossing a variety of terrain such as the Atacama Desert and Andes Mountains, covering 5000km it ends back in Buenos Aries on 18th of January.
